mirror of https://github.com/zcash/halo2.git
942 B
942 B
Changelog
All notable changes to this project will be documented in this file.
The format is based on Keep a Changelog, and this project adheres to Rust's notion of Semantic Versioning.
[Unreleased]
Changed
halo2::plonk::Error
has been overhauled:Error
now implementsstd::fmt::Display
andstd::error::Error
.Error
no longer implementsPartialEq
. Tests can check for specific error cases withassert!(matches!(..))
.Error::IncompatibleParams
is nowError::InvalidInstances
.Error::OpeningError
is nowError::Opening
.Error::SynthesisError
is nowError::Synthesis
.Error::TranscriptError
is nowError::Transcript
, and stores the underlyingio::Error
.
Removed
halo2::arithmetic::BatchInvert
(useff::BatchInvert
instead).
[0.1.0-beta.1] - 2021-09-24
Initial beta release!